A holiday in the Vendée will certainly leave you spoilt for choice in terms of how you spend your day. Most families love St Jean de Monts, a modern resort that’s ideal for a lively family holiday. With a bustling promenade, a wide, sandy beach and and great market, there really is something for everyone. After an adrenaline-packed day at the Atlantic Toboggan Waterpark at St Hilaire de Riez, calm everyone down with a visit inland to the Marais Poitevin where you can explore the peaceful network of canals of ‘Green Venice’ in a flat-bottomed boat.
